Legitimate overrides are created only through the manager console and carry a signed approval entry; an acceptance without one may indicate a bypassed API check or tampered clock on the ordering node. On trigger, capture the order payload, the node's reported time, and the override table state before any mitigation. The investigation checklist and escalation criteria are maintained on the page below.

dashboard of tawef-hagug = https://superset.norvadyn.local/display/projects/build/ticket/build/spaces/ticket/1e989f0e6c200d20fc4ae06b

## Changelog — tailpike CLI v2.0

Defaults changed for the internal log-tailing CLI. The default environment is now staging instead of prod, so support agents must pass a flag explicitly to tail production. Follow mode defaults off; line buffer raised to 2,000. Timestamps render in UTC by default rather than local time, which resolves the cross-region confusion from the Ostermill incident. Older scripts may break. The new default configuration values shipped with this release are below.

deployment values, yadug-bawif:
[framir]
team = pelox
access_code = ac_a38ab2
owner = tamion.julael
host = framir.tolvaqlabs.test
port = 11211
peer = tammir.zemvargrid.local
salt = 2215ef03
pin = 1541

## Authentication

Policy: all auth dependencies are pinned to exact versions. No ranges, no carets. The Lanternwell SDK broke us twice last quarter; we don't float anything touching token exchange anymore. Upgrades go through Marisol's review queue and land behind a flag. Lockfile changes to auth packages require two approvals. CI rejects unpinned transitive deps via the audit step added in sprint 41. For local testing against the Corvid staging gateway, use the key below.

app token of kawif-yafop = zpat2_88